Output 75c6596d16cd3cfc80202cc2e83916ff0946de12b71d3ae7f5396ecba66ba884:0

value
39590885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26c81cf23a349784a036bc76f63aece316e4a283 OP_EQUALVERIFY OP_CHECKSIG
address
14Y4QPbFMu78wWoT59UYq2iJvuKJDEHkV6
transaction
75c6596d16cd3cfc80202cc2e83916ff0946de12b71d3ae7f5396ecba66ba884
spent
true